Fire Pump Controller Configured to Control Pressure Maintenance in Sprinkler Systems
20180008850 · 2018-01-11 ·

Example devices, systems, and methods disclosed herein relate to a controller configured to control pressure maintenance in a fire protection system. A controller may be configured to control a fire pump to provide a first level of water pressure and to control operation of a jockey pump that is coupled in parallel with the fire pump to provide a second level of water pressure that is less than the first level. The controller is further configured to receive, from a pressure sensor coupled to the fire protection system, an output representative of the water pressure. The controller is configured to provide instructions to initiate the jockey pump based on a pressure value associated with the output being below a first value, and to provide instructions to initiate the fire pump based on the pressure value being below a second value that is less than the first value.

STEEL COATED METAL STRUCTURES AND METHODS OF FABRICATING THE SAME
20180008851 · 2018-01-11 ·

An elongated hollow component includes a body extending from a first end to a second end and defining a longitudinal axis. The body includes a plurality of layers each circumscribing the longitudinal axis. The plurality of layers includes a base layer including a first steel material, and an inner surface coating coupled to a radially inner surface of the base layer. The inner surface coating includes a second steel material.

METHOD AND SYSTEM FOR PROVIDING A CENTRALIZED APPLIANCE HUB

An appliance hub for use in an upper portion of an enclosure can include a substrate configured to be positioned in an upper portion of an enclosure. The appliance hub can include a climate control apparatus mounted on the substrate and the climate control apparatus can be configured to regulate a temperature within the enclosure. The appliance hub can include one or more lighting elements configured to provide light within the enclosure, a plurality of fluid lines connected to the substrate and configured to provide fluid service and return to the climate control apparatus, and/or a plurality of electrical connections connected to the substrate and configured to provide electrical power and/or data to at least one of the climate control apparatus and the one or more lighting elements.

COMBINED HVAC AND FIRE SUPPRESSION SYSTEM
20230233893 · 2023-07-27 ·

A combined HVAC and fire suppression system includes a HVAC apparatus and a fluid outlet for release of heat exchange fluid into a discharge plenum of the HVAC system. The heat exchange fluid is a clean agent, such that release of the heat exchange fluid into the discharge plenum provides a fire suppressant effect for a conditioned space. The HVAC apparatus includes a network of piping holding a heat exchange fluid and arranged for chilling the heat exchange fluid via a chiller connected to the piping; a fan coil unit connected to the network of piping, the fan coil unit includes a coil for passage of the heat exchange fluid chilled by the chiller, a fan for movement of air over the coil in order to transfer heat from the air to the heat exchange fluid in the coil, and the discharge plenum.

SYSTEMS AND METHODS OF FIRE SUPPRESSION IN A CORRIDOR
20230234080 · 2023-07-27 · ·

Systems and apparatuses of a sprinkler frame having an upper section, a lower section, and a channel extending along a sprinkler axis are provided. The lower section can include apertures through the frame, a guide pin having a first end with a head, a second end, and a shaft extending therebetween. The shaft of the guide pin can translate in an axial direction of the sprinkler axis within the apertures of the sprinkler frame. The deflector can couple with the second end of the guide pin and can include a first side, second side, third side, and fourth side. The first side and the second side may be smaller than the third side and the fourth side and can include an end profile defining a first tine, second tine, third tine, and fourth tine separating a first slot, second slot, and third slot.

FIRE PROTECTION SYSTEM PIPE FITTINGS

A fire protection system can include one or more pipes coupled with a fluid source, a pipe fitting coupled with the one or more pipes downstream of the fluid source, and at least one sprinkler coupled with the one or more pipes and the pipe fitting. The pipe fitting can include a wall defining an opening, the wall having an outer diameter, a first wall thickness at the opening, and a second wall thickness inward from the opening, the second wall thickness greater than the first wall thickness. The at least one sprinkler can be coupled with the one or more pipes and the pipe fitting to receive fluid from the fluid source through the one or more pipes and the pipe fitting.

ADJUSTABLE DEFLECTOR TO FLOOR SPRINKLER ADAPTER FOR SLOPED CEILING
20230001248 · 2023-01-05 · ·

A fire suppression system includes a pipe system in communication with a fluid supply, a connector, at least one adapter pipe, and a sprinkler. The pipe system includes a first pipe and a second pipe that define a fluid supply axis oriented at an angle relative to a floor below the first pipe and the second pipe. The connector includes a connector inlet engaged with the first pipe, a connector outlet engaged with the second pipe, and an adapter outlet in communication with the connector inlet and the connector outlet. The at least one adapter pipe is engaged with the adapter outlet of the connector. The sprinkler is coupled with the at least one adapter pipe such that a spray pattern of fluid outputted by the sprinkler is oriented to correspond with a target orientation of the spray pattern.
